Dear Peter:
What a welcome service you’re providing on this blog. It’s been invaluable to this blogger, and to so many others.
The proceedings as I’ve watched them remind me that the pooling of ignorance in search of truth is not the best standard of the Church; and that self-confident radicals operating through synods are NOT the equivalent of an ecumenical council, nor a Pope, nor the doctrine and worship of the Anglican formularies. Trying to change fundamental moral and theological realities by such means is deeply offensive not only to the magisterial Reformation, but the wider catholic church now and down the ages.
The real challenge here is not the power to make stuff up according to the spirit of the age or social engineering or our good intentions, but to ask “By what authority?” and “Where shall we draw this or any line?” That question is the ghostly giant striding through the General Synod hall.
May the witness and example and prayers of Blessed Saint John the Baptist– patron-saint of Canada– through the blessing of the Father, the grace of our Lord Jesus Christ, and the power of the Holy Spirit forestall this destruction we are willing upon ourselves, this departing from God’s express will and purpose.
Endless debate and discussion of settled matters will not do; or if made to do, they won’t do very well. The liberal Anglican circle is not being drawn ever-wider, but is shrinking into irrelevance and evil and confusion and schism.

A voice on the Synod floor from one Aboriginal Youth
My name is Dean Sewap from Cree Pelican, the Diocese of Saskatchewan. If this is passed I would feel that to be faithful in my walk with Jesus, I would need to leave the Anglican Church. I don’t want to leave. I love my church. First nations parishes feel strongly about this but I feel that our voice is not being heard. Please be patient with us. Now is not the time to go ahead with this. God bless you.
